uh oh.... here's an email i got from chrisq102@hotmail.com , the guy who asked where i lived.
Good...! Must have sounded strange, but here's the deal: I get flooded with email requests for whatever the current single is from Shania; it's a campaign from her fanclub. Emailed requests come in from, literally, all over the world. It cripples my email account keeping me from getting to the real email from real Q102 listeners, and instead of playing the song I skip it for each of these "foreign" requests I receive. But knowing that you're legit, i'll be sure to get it on for you! have a great day!
LOL when you're requesting, make sure u know where the station is, so if they ask u where you're from, u know what to tell them.

Not too sure about that. Just because you have the ability to listen doesn't mean you are.
The DJ's and PD's know they are getting requests from people who aren't listeners. Clogging their e-mail may result in just ticking them off and making them not play the song.
If any PD or DJ wanted to take just a few minutes and check out the fans web sites, for any artist, they would see they are getting requests from people who aren't listening. You would only have to spend about 10 minutes here to find that out. We aren't even hiding the fact people here are requesting at stations they arenot listening to.
I really don't think you are doing Shania, or any artist, a favour by requesting at a station you are not listening to. But thats just my opinion.
You may find requests to your local radio station have better results. Bombarding radio stations all over the US doesn't seem to be working.
